WTK 1944 original or not Door snaps??

Post by waterdawg2004 » Sat Jan 20, 2018 4:17 pm

Do all WWII jeeps have door snaps or not. I have been looking at online pics and it is hard to tell. My 1944 MB does not have any? Also it does not have a heat riser in manifold, or torque reaction spring on the drivers side. Please advise and thanks for any info. See attached pics.

Re: WTK 1944 original or not Door snaps??

Post by Ernie Baals » Sat Jan 20, 2018 5:27 pm

They all had door snaps from the factory
And yours also would have had the torque reaction spring

Re: WTK 1944 original or not Door snaps??

Post by twinflyer17 » Mon Jan 22, 2018 5:40 am

The body either had the half door snap holes filled in at one point, or it's repro. As Ernie said, all bodies came with the snaps out of the factory.
